Radish alpha
H
rad:z3QDZAW2FAfuLvihrhiyDC9fAD8G9
HardenedBSD Package Manager
Radicle
Git
utils: prevent potential buffer overflow
Baptiste Daroussin committed 2 months ago
commit 48f73f1cd60e72a275f468a36dee5d0c5fd1b2e5
parent e5baad4
1 file changed +1 -1
modified libpkg/utils.c
@@ -1119,7 +1119,7 @@ str_ends_with(const char *str, const char *end)
	el = strlen(end);
	if (sl < el)
		return (false);
-
	return (strncmp(str + (sl - el), end, (sl - el)) == 0);
+
	return (strncmp(str + (sl - el), end, el) == 0);
}

int